Basic Concepts of Compressor Housing
A compressor housing is a part of the turbocharger that encases the compressor wheel. Its function is to direct and manage the flow of air into the engine. Within the turbocharger, the compressor housing works alongside the turbine housing to increase the engine’s air intake, which is compressed before entering the combustion chamber. This process, known as turbocharging, allows for more fuel to be burned, resulting in increased power output and efficiency. The compressor housing contributes to this by ensuring that the air is compressed effectively and delivered smoothly to the engine 1.

Role of Compressor Housing in Turbocharger Systems
The compressor housing, specifically part 3533297, is integral to the operation of both aftermarket turbochargers and standard turbocharger setups. Within a turbocharger system, this housing encases the compressor wheel, which is driven by the turbine side of the turbocharger.
When the exhaust gases spin the turbine, the connected compressor wheel within the housing compresses the intake air. This pressurized air is then delivered to the engine’s intake manifold, enhancing the combustion process by allowing more fuel to be burned, which in turn increases power output.
In a turbocharger kit, the compressor housing is often designed to work in harmony with other components such as the intercooler, which cools the compressed air before it enters the engine, and the wastegate, which regulates the amount of exhaust gas flowing through the turbine to control boost levels.
The efficiency and design of the compressor housing directly influence the performance characteristics of the turbocharger. A well-designed housing can improve airflow, reduce turbulence, and enhance the overall efficiency of the turbocharger system.
